BLANKEN- BUSH, CROUCH, FINCH, HAWLEY, JOHNS, LUPINACCI, McLAUGHLIN -- read once and referred to the Committee on Ways and Means AN ACT to amend the tax law, in relation to creating a sales tax exemption for green technology companies purchasing manufacturing equipment; and providing for the repeal of such provisions upon expi- ration thereof THE PEOPLE OF THE STATE OF NEW YORK, REPRESENTED IN SENATE AND ASSEM- BLY, DO ENACT AS FOLLOWS: Section 1. The tax law is amended by adding a new section 1124 to read as follows: S 1124. EXEMPTION FROM TAX ON MANUFACTURING EQUIPMENT PURCHASES FOR GREEN TECHNOLOGY COMPANIES. (A) QUALIFYING GREEN TECHNOLOGY COMPANIES SHALL BE EXEMPT FROM THE SALES TAXES IMPOSED UNDER THIS ARTICLE WHEN PURCHASING NECESSARY MANUFACTURING EQUIPMENT TO BE USED IN CARRYING ON A GREEN TECHNOLOGY TRADE OR BUSINESS IN ACCORDANCE WITH THE PROVISIONS OF THIS SECTION. (B) TO QUALIFY FOR TAX EXEMPT STATUS ELIGIBLE COMPANIES SHALL APPLY TO THE COMMISSIONER WHO SHALL EVALUATE THE APPLICATION PURSUANT TO THE GUIDELINES IN THIS SECTION AND RENDER A DECISION APPROVING OR DENYING THE APPLICATION. APPLICATIONS SHALL BE SUBMITTED FOR EACH ELIGIBLE PROJECT ON AN INDIVIDUAL BASIS AND SHALL STATE THE TOTAL DOLLAR AMOUNT THAT WILL BE EXPENDED ON THE PURCHASE. (C) THE COMMISSIONER SHALL PUBLISH NOTICE OF THE AVAILABILITY OF PROJECT APPLICATIONS AND DEADLINES FOR SUBMISSION OF PROJECT APPLICA- TIONS TO THE COMMISSIONER AND SHALL EVALUATE PROJECT APPLICATIONS BASED UPON THE FOLLOWING CRITERIA: 1. THE EXTENT TO WHICH THE PROJECT DEVELOPS MANUFACTURING FACILITIES, OR PURCHASES EQUIPMENT FOR MANUFACTURING FACILITIES, LOCATED IN NEW YORK.
